我正在嘗試使用該Hudson Gerrit Trigger插件。無(wú)論出于何種原因,Gerrit都不接受SSH位于的密鑰/var/lib/hudson/.ssh/id_rsa。在GUI中,我得到Connection error : com.jcraft.jsch.JSchException: Auth fail一個(gè)錯(cuò)誤,而當(dāng)我在終端上工作時(shí),我得到了一個(gè)Permission denied (publickey)錯(cuò)誤。如何生成和使用有效的私鑰Hudson,Gerrit使其發(fā)揮良好作用?
2 回答

夢(mèng)里花落0921
TA貢獻(xiàn)1772條經(jīng)驗(yàn) 獲得超6個(gè)贊
“哪里是$HOME
為hudson
用戶?”。究竟。我在SO上看到的問(wèn)題是什么,以及與ssh有關(guān)的Hudson問(wèn)題的一般難度。執(zhí)行該Job時(shí),您需要以某種方式顯示環(huán)境變量,并查看是否$HOME
提到了。
- 2 回答
- 0 關(guān)注
- 741 瀏覽
添加回答
舉報(bào)
0/150
提交
取消